“…Shear waves can be generated by mechanical vibration in one-dimensional or two-dimensional transient elastography or by an ARFI in point- and two-dimensional shear wave elastography (p-SWE and 2D-SWE, respectively). The results of SWE can be displayed as either shear wave speed (m/s) or shear or Young’s modulus (kPa) due to the relation expressed in Equation (2) [ 5 , 7 ], but elasticity scale allows for more discrimination between stiffness values [ 8 ].…”
